Altered glucose metabolism and hypoxic response in alloxan-induced diabetic atherosclerosis in rabbits
Diabetes mellitus accelerates atherosclerosis that causes most cardiovascular events. Several metabolic pathways are considered to contribute to the development of atherosclerosis, but comprehensive metabolic alterations to atherosclerotic arterial cells remain unknown.
